Stater Bros. Markets of San Bernardino, Calif., has promoted Mike Reed to senior vice president and chief financial officer. The promotion, effective immediately, follows the recent retirement of Dave Harris, former executive vice president for finance, chief financial officer and principal accounting officer, according to a news release.

Reed will report to CEO and Chairman Pete Van Helden and will be responsible for the financial accountability of the company, the release said. Additionally, Reed will continue overseeing the company’s real estate development and serving on the executive leadership team.

“It has been a pleasure working with Mike over the last several years as he has overseen the opening of several new stores and the remodeling of numerous existing locations,” Van Helden said in the release. “With Mike overseeing the company’s finances, Stater Bros. will be well-positioned for success well into the future.”

Reed has over 23 years of retail real estate development experience, according to the release. He has been a member of the Stater Bros. Markets team for nearly 10 years, joining the company in 2014 as a senior director in the real estate and property management department.

In 2016, he was promoted to vice president for real estate and, in 2018, was elevated to senior vice president for real estate and development, assuming responsibilities of construction, store design, equipment purchasing and facilities maintenance, which includes refrigeration, energy management, general maintenance and special maintenance projects.

In 2021, Reed took on his most recent role of senior vice president property development and finance, where he continued to oversee real estate development and assumed the additional responsibility of corporate finance and accounting operations. During that time, he was also tasked with integrating the company’s real estate and finance functions to help the company achieve greater operational efficiency.

Reed holds a Master of Science in food industry leadership from the University of Southern California and a Bachelor of Business Administration in finance from Boise State University, the release said. He sits on the board of directors of the Air Conditioning Contractors Association and currently serves as its treasurer. In addition, he is a trustee and current chairman of the Inland Refrigeration and Air Conditioning Trust Fund. Reed is also a member and past state retail chairman of the International Council of Shopping Centers.
